Automated AI Incident Handling & AI-SOC Optimization Essentials Training by Tonex
This training covers AI-driven security operations and automated incident response. Participants learn how AI enhances Security Operations Centers (SOCs), improves threat detection, and streamlines response strategies. The course explores AI-based threat intelligence, anomaly detection, and optimization techniques for security workflows. Attendees gain insights into AI-driven decision-making, risk mitigation, and automated security management. Real-world case studies highlight AI’s role in modern cybersecurity. This program equips professionals with the skills to leverage AI for proactive security operations and incident handling.
